Examples.
C# code:
// script ""
using System.Windows.Controls;
var b = new wpfBuilder("Window").WinSize(400);
b.R.Add("How Many", out TextBox generic_t1).Focus();
b.R.AddButton("go", printIt);
b.End();
if (!b.ShowDialog()) return;
void printIt(WBButtonClickArgs args) {
print.it(generic_t1.Text);
}
C# code:
// script ""
using System.Windows.Controls;
TextBox generic_t1 = null;
var b = new wpfBuilder("Window").WinSize(400);
b.R.AddButton("go", printIt);
b.R.Add("How Many", out generic_t1).Focus();
b.End();
if (!b.ShowDialog()) return;
void printIt(WBButtonClickArgs args) {
print.it(generic_t1.Text);
}
C# code:
// script ""
using System.Windows.Controls;
var b = new wpfBuilder("Window").WinSize(400);
b.R.Add(out Button go, "go");
b.R.Add("How Many", out TextBox generic_t1).Focus();
b.End();
go.Click+=(_,_)=> { printIt(); };
if (!b.ShowDialog()) return;
void printIt() {
print.it(generic_t1.Text);
}
C# code:
// script "" /// See menu File -> New -> Dialogs.
using System.Windows;
using System.Windows.Controls;
var d = new DialogClass();
d.ShowDialog();
class DialogClass : Window {
TextBox generic_t1;
public DialogClass() {
Title = "Dialog";
var b = new wpfBuilder(this).WinSize(400);
b.R.Add("How Many", out generic_t1).Focus();
b.R.AddButton("go", _ => printIt());
b.R.AddOkCancel();
b.End();
// b.Loaded += ()=> {
//
// };
b.OkApply += e => {
print.it(generic_t1.Text);
};
}
void printIt() {
print.it(generic_t1.Text);
}
}